What companies run services between Cork, Ireland and Legan, Ireland?

You can take a train from Cork to Legan via Dublin Heuston, Heuston, George's Dock, Dublin Connolly, and Edgeworthstown in around 5h 38m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Cork Alfred Street to Legan via Parkgate Street, Heuston Station, Liffey Valley SC, and Ballinalack in around 6h 50m.
